Remembering IT2 Timothy T. Eckels, USN, KIA USS John S. McCain

Born on October 31, 1993 in Baltimore City, Maryland to Timothy Thomas Eckels and Rachel (Pinkston) Eckels, IT2 Timothy Thomas Eckels graduated from Manchester Valley High School in 2012.  On August 21, 2017, Eckels was killed when the USS John S. McCain he was serving in was involved in a collision with the Liberian-flagged tanker off the coast of Singapore and Malaysia, east of the Strait of Malacca.  A total of 10 Sailors were killed.

Celebrating a Change of Command and Retirement

On October 28, 2022, NIOC Georgia celebrated the change of command with CAPT Joel Yates properly relieving CAPT Dom Lovello as Commanding Officer/Commander Task Force 1050.  Immediately following the change of command ceremony, CAPT Dom Lovello retired.

Honoring Captain Dominic R. Lovello, USN, TF 1050/CO NIOC Georgia

Tomorrow, Captain Dom Lovello retires after 38 years of service.  A highly respected Naval Officer, Captain Lovello served our great nation and Navy with honor and distinction as and a Cryptologic Warfare Officer.  Enlisting in the Navy as an E-1, Dom Lovello advanced to Chief Petty Officer, received an officer commission through the Limited Duty Officer program and finally lateral transferred to Special Duty Officer (Cryptologic Warfare), achieving the rank of Captain!  Captain Lovello’s biography, command achievements and End of Tour award follow:

A Conversation with Rear Adm. Tracy Hines

Rear Adm. Tracy Hines is the Director, Enterprise Networks and Cybersecurity, for the Office of the Chief of Naval Operations for Information Warfare (OPNAV N2N6). She received her commission through the Limited Duty Officer Program in 1996 and graduated from American InterContinental University with a degree in business management in 2004, and laterally transferred into the Information Warfare community in 2007. Rear Adm. Hines received a master’s degree in information technology cyber forensics from Trident University in 2009.

Japanese Carrier Zuikaku

October 25, 1944, U.S. Navy aircraft sank the Zuikaku, the last surviving Japanese carrier that had participated in the attack on Pearl Harbor. With the Zuikaku listing heavily to port just before rolling over and sinking, the crew salutes the Japanese naval ensign as it is lowered.
